Today, Chinachem Group and MTR Corporation's joint development at Ho Man Tin station, Phase IA Yu One Sky Sea, recorded a sale of a two-bedroom terrace unit facing Victoria Harbour, for HK$17.05 million. The unit, at 2A Tower, 1st floor, Unit C, has a saleable area of 550 square feet, with a 159-square-foot terrace, and a two-bedroom-plus-storage layout. The transaction price was HK$17.05 million, or HK$31,000 per square foot.
The project has sold 124 harbour-facing units to date, with total proceeds exceeding HK$3 billion, at an average price of over HK$32,900 per square foot. Only one similar two-bedroom terrace unit remains for sale: Unit B on the 1st floor of Tower 2A, with a saleable area of 555 square feet and a 152-square-foot terrace. The Yu One series has cumulatively sold 763 units, representing over 90% of the entire development, with total sales exceeding HK$13.4 billion.
